About the Role:

As an Ground Station Engineer at Planet you will be a member of an Operations and Development team focused on >99% uptime of a geographically diverse Ground Station network. The network is composed of a mix of cloud infrastructure, physical servers, networking equipment, and industrial controllers working in unison to autonomously track and communicate with Planet’s 150+ satellite constellation.

Planet’s satellites generate a substantial dataset and moving that data across the Ground Station network daily poses ever changing design goals for our Operations Team. The Ground Station team works closely with Spacecraft Operators and Mission Control engineers to autonomously control the spacecraft and bring the data back to Earth.
